Mike is a self-employed TV technician.He is usually paid as soon as he completes repairs, but occasionally bills a customer with payment expected within 30 days.At the end of the year he has $2,500 of receivables outstanding.He expects to collect $1,200 of this and write off the remainder.Mike is a cash basis taxpayer and had net earnings from his business (not including the effect of the items above) of $55,000.He also had $3,500 interest income, $200 gambling winnings, and sold corporate stock for $7,000.The stock had been purchased in 2009 for $8,200.Mike is single, has no dependents, and claims the standard deduction.What is his 2012 taxable income? (Ignore the self-employment tax deduction.)

Boolean Algebra

A branch of algebra that deals with true or false values, typically used in computer logic and circuit design.

Real-time Processing

Computing that processes data as it is received, ensuring immediate output and responses.

Data Redundancy

The duplication of data in multiple places within a database or information storage system, often to increase reliability or improve performance.

Normalization

The process of organizing the fields and tables of a database to minimize redundancy and dependency.
